What Factors Lead to Grime Accumulation on Quarry Tiles Over Time?

Conditions in Busy Kitchens and Utility Rooms

In high-traffic areas like kitchens and utility rooms, quarry tiles face a barrage of cooking oils, spills, and foot traffic. Over time, these substances do not just sit on the surface; they infiltrate the porous clay material, forming layers that resist conventional cleaning methods. When tiles are unsealed or poorly maintained, this absorption becomes more pronounced, leading to a dull and uneven floor appearance, even with regular mopping. The combination of moisture, oils, and dirt creates an ideal environment for grime accumulation, making a more comprehensive cleaning approach necessary to restore the tiles to their original state.

How Do Oil, Wax, and Soil Affect the Longevity of Your Tiles?

Historically, many older homes applied wax-based finishes or oil treatments to protect their quarry tiles. While these methods provided a temporary shine, they inadvertently trapped airborne dust and residues from cooking. As these layers built up, they formed a sticky film that adhered to soil particles. This problem goes beyond mere aesthetics; it significantly impacts traction, hygiene, and the tile’s ability to breathe. Removing these layers requires more than just basic scrubbing; it involves a combination of chemical breakdown and mechanical agitation for effective restoration. Ignoring these underlying concerns can lead to further deterioration over time, necessitating even more extensive restoration efforts in the future.

How Can You Recognize When Your Quarry Tiles Need Deep Cleaning?

Signs Your Quarry Tiles Need Deep Cleaning

What Are the Visual and Tactile Signs of Embedded Dirt?

It is easy to mistakenly think a floor is clean if it appears uniformly red, but quarry tiles often hide accumulated grime beneath their surface. A floor that has just been mopped may still feel sticky or greasy when walked upon. If you wipe a damp cloth across the tile and it returns stained or oily, this indicates ingrained residues are present. Additionally, uneven sheen — where certain areas remain dull despite scrubbing efforts — often points to wax buildup or dirt trapped beneath layers of old polish. Recognizing these signs early can prevent further damage and ensure a more effective deep cleaning process.

What Makes Some Homes Particularly Prone to Grime Buildup?

Many homes feature aging kitchens and utility areas that have not been updated in decades. These spaces often include original quarry tiles that either remain unsealed or have been treated with outdated wax products. Over time, layers of cooking oils, detergent runoff, and tracked-in dirt accumulate. Due to the porous and unglazed nature of these tiles, they act like sponges, especially in homes with pets, children, or high foot traffic. Even if the surface appears intact, the hidden grime can severely compromise both hygiene and visual appeal. Being aware of these factors enables homeowners to take proactive steps in maintaining their quarry tile floors.

What Are the Risks of Using Off-the-Shelf Cleaners?

Most supermarket tile cleaners are designed for superficial dirt removal. They may contain mild surfactants or acidic components that provide a temporary shine, but they seldom penetrate the layers of wax, oil, and soil embedded in quarry tiles. In fact, frequent use of acidic cleaning products can etch the tile surface, making it more porous and vulnerable to future staining. Homeowners often find that despite regular cleaning efforts, the tiles still feel sticky or discolored — a clear indication that deeper intervention is necessary. Relying solely on these products can create a false sense of cleanliness, masking deeper issues that require professional attention.

Can You Successfully Restore Quarry Tiles Without Causing Harm?

Restoration involves breaking down years of buildup without damaging the underlying clay structure. While quarry tiles are durable, they are also absorbent and sensitive to harsh treatments. Excessive scrubbing or improper chemical use can lead to uneven results or irreversible damage. Professional methods depend on controlled chemical reactions and mechanical agitation tailored to the specific condition of the tile. Achieving this delicate balance is challenging with DIY tools, which typically lack the necessary power and precision for safe restoration. Understanding the significance of professional techniques can save homeowners time, money, and potential damage in the long run.

Exploring Industrial Cleaning Techniques for Quarry Tiles

Alkaline Cleaners vs. Sealer Strippers: Essential Information

To eliminate decades of grime, professionals utilize two primary chemical strategies: alkaline degreasers and sealer strippers.

  • Alkaline cleaners excel at removing organic residues such as cooking oils, dirt, and everyday grime. They work by emulsifying grease, allowing for effective rinsing without damaging the tile’s surface.
  • Solvent-based sealer removers are used when layers of wax, topical sealers, or polish are present. These traditional solvent-based strippers dissolve synthetic coatings rapidly but can be harsh and produce strong fumes.
  • Non-solvent sealer removers, such as LTP Solvex, offer a safer alternative. These non-solvent strippers penetrate the sealer and gradually soften it — similar to how paint strippers dissolve old coatings. Instead of immediate dissolution, they are allowed to dwell for several hours or even overnight. Once softened, the residue can be removed mechanically using scrubbing pads and water.

The choice of the right product depends on your available timeframe, your tolerance for strong fumes, and the type of buildup you are dealing with. For deep restoration — especially in cases where old sealers are an issue — a dwell-based stripper like LTP Solvex provides a more controlled and less aggressive solution. It gradually softens the sealer, making it easier to remove with scrubbing pads and water, without relying on harsh solvents or rapid chemical actions. Understanding these options allows homeowners to make informed choices regarding their cleaning strategies.

Why Are Rotary Scrubbers More Effective Than Manual Brushing?

Mechanical agitation is crucial for the effective restoration of quarry tiles. Rotary scrubbers use weighted heads and stiff brushes to drive cleaning agents deep into the tile’s surface. This approach proves to be significantly more effective than manual brushing, which often just skims the surface and fails to thoroughly eliminate residues. The combination of chemical dwell time and machine pressure ensures that embedded grime is lifted without harming the clay. For large areas or severe buildup, rotary machines deliver consistent results that manual methods simply cannot achieve. Recognizing the advantages of professional equipment can lead to a more effective and efficient cleaning process.

Choosing the Right Chemicals for Quarry Tile Restoration

How to Safely Use High-PH Cleaners

High pH alkaline cleaners are essential for breaking down organic grime, but they require careful application. These powerful degreasers engage with oils and fats, lifting them from the tile’s surface. However, proper dilution and dwell time are critical to avoid streaking or residue. In professional settings, technicians conduct tests on small areas first and meticulously monitor the reaction. Homeowners attempting this without appropriate training risk encountering uneven results or chemical burns to surrounding surfaces. Understanding the nuances of these chemicals ensures safer and more effective cleaning experiences.

When Are Stripping Treatments Necessary?

Solvent strippers become vital when wax, polish, or synthetic sealers have accumulated over time. These chemicals effectively dissolve coatings that trap grime beneath the surface, allowing for proper cleaning of the tile. Given that solvents can emit strong fumes and negatively impact indoor air quality, they should only be used in well-ventilated areas and with suitable protective gear. In older homes, chemical stripping often serves as the primary method to reach the original tile surface, particularly in kitchens where wax-based treatments were common in the past. Recognizing when to employ these treatments can significantly enhance cleaning results.

The Critical Role of Mechanical Agitation in the Cleaning Process

How Do Rotary Machines Effectively Lift Embedded Grime?

Rotary machines utilize weighted heads and stiff bristle pads to agitate the surface of quarry tiles. This process focuses on applying consistent pressure and motion to dislodge grime from deep within the tile’s pores. The rotation of the machine aids in emulsifying the dirt, allowing it to rise to the surface for safe rinsing. Without this mechanical lift, even potent chemicals may fail to completely eliminate residues. Utilizing rotary machines guarantees a comprehensive clean that manual methods simply cannot achieve, making them the preferred choice in professional cleaning environments.

Our company employs these machines for most floor cleaning tasks, opting for hand pads in corners and edges where mechanical brushes and pads may not be effective. This combination ensures thorough cleaning while addressing the unique challenges associated with quarry tiles.

Why Are Pressure and Dwell Time Essential for Effective Cleaning?

Successful cleaning depends not only on the right tools but also on the pressure applied by the machine and the length of time the chemical remains on the tile — known as dwell time — both of which are critical factors. Insufficient dwell time means the cleaner does not effectively break down the grime, while excessive pressure can damage the tile’s surface. Professionals expertly calibrate these variables based on the tile’s condition, ensuring a thorough clean while protecting the floor’s integrity. Understanding these aspects can significantly improve the effectiveness of the cleaning process.

The Importance of Sealing and Long-Term Care After Cleaning

When and How to Apply Sealant for Optimal Protection

Once quarry tiles are thoroughly cleaned and completely dry, it is crucial to apply a sealant to protect them from future staining and damage. Selecting the right time and product for sealing can greatly affect the longevity and appearance of the tiles.

Understanding the Difference: Impregnating vs. Penetrating Sealers

A breathable, penetrating sealer is most appropriate for unglazed clay surfaces, particularly on floors lacking a damp-proof membrane. These products penetrate the tile to create a barrier that resists both oil and water while maintaining the natural look of the tile. Timing is key — sealing too soon after cleaning risks trapping moisture, whereas waiting too long can allow new dirt to settle. Generally, sealing should occur within 24 to 48 hours post-cleaning, as long as the tiles are completely dry. Understanding the importance of proper sealing can prevent future issues and maintain the tiles’ integrity.

Looking for a Sheen? Explore Topical Sealers

For those desiring a satin or gloss finish, a topical sealer such as LTP Ironwax Satin offers a valuable alternative. These sealers sit on the tile’s surface, enhancing its sheen while helping to hide minor surface imperfections. They also simplify the cleaning process — particularly beneficial for older quarry tiles exhibiting surface damage or crevices where dirt is prone to gather. However, topical sealers are not suitable for damp-prone floors. Since they form a surface film, any moisture trapped underneath can lead to whitening, flaking, or adhesion difficulties. Always ensure the floor is entirely dry and free from rising damp before applying a topical finish. Recognizing the appropriate sealing method is essential for extending the life of your tiles.

How Often Should You Reclean or Reseal Your Quarry Tiles?

Sealing is not a one-time fix. In high-traffic areas like kitchens and utility rooms, the protective layer diminishes over time. Most quarry tile floors benefit from resealing every 2 to 4 years, depending on usage and cleaning practices. Regular maintenance — such as dry sweeping and using pH-neutral cleaners — helps prolong the sealer’s life. If tiles start absorbing water quickly or show signs of darkening when wet, it indicates that the sealer has deteriorated and needs reapplication. Understanding the best maintenance practices can help homeowners keep their quarry tiles looking pristine.

Common Questions from Homeowners About Quarry Tile Care

Will Deep Cleaning Change the Color of My Tiles?

In most cases, deep cleaning restores the tiles to their original color instead of altering it. Years of accumulated grime can darken or dull the surface, so removing these layers often results in the tile appearing brighter or more vibrant. This is not a color change; rather, it signifies a return to the tile’s natural state. If wax or polish has yellowed over time, removing it can reveal the true color underneath. Understanding this process can alleviate concerns about potential color changes during deep cleaning.

Is Industrial Quarry Tile Restoration Messy or Disruptive?

While industrial cleaning involves machinery and chemicals, the process is controlled and contained. Rotary scrubbers typically use minimal water and extract waste as cleaning progresses. Many homeowners are surprised by how tidy the process is, especially compared to DIY attempts that often leave streaks or residues. Proper ventilation and preparation further minimize disruption, making it a manageable task even in busy households. Recognizing the efficiency of professional techniques can encourage homeowners to consider this option for their cleaning needs.

Can I Maintain the Results on My Own?

Certainly — once the tiles have been restored and sealed, ongoing maintenance is straightforward. Regular dry sweeping and occasional mopping with pH-neutral cleaners will keep the surface clean without compromising the sealer’s integrity. Avoid using acidic or bleach-based products, as these can degrade the protective layer. With appropriate care, rejuvenated quarry tiles can remain beautiful and functional for many years, even in high-traffic areas. Understanding the best practices for upkeep ensures that homeowners can enjoy their restored tiles for the long term.
